Hays Education in Chesterfield is seeking Learning Support Assistants to support students in schools and SEND settings.

You will work with teachers to foster an inclusive classroom and provide targeted support to pupils who need extra help.

Applicants should have prior experience mentoring or assisting children or young people, and demonstrate patience, empathy and strong communication skills.

This role offers flexible day-to-day work with various assignments.
